A Mid-Century classic reimagined to perfection

If you've been searching for your forever home, a home unlike anything else on the market, look no further - this one is truly in a class of its own. Built in the 1960s & masterfully reimagined, this solid brick family sanctuary, positioned on an 839m2* allotment, is a true labour of love. The transformation seamlessly fuses the home’s modernist soul with refined contemporary design. Above all, this is a home designed to be lived in, not only to be admired, but genuinely enjoyed, where every detail enhances daily life & guests instinctively want to stay long after they've arrived. Beyond the original front door, an elegant entrance hallway with hardwood floors & retained timber detailing pays homage to the home's mid-century origins & leads to the breathtaking upper level. From the moment you arrive, the exceptional design, craftsmanship & cohesion are immediately apparent. Every space has been thoughtfully considered & every detail meticulously selected, resulting in a home that is not only visually captivating but remarkably functional, warm & welcoming. Rich timber, exquisite Carrara marble, custom joinery, V-groove cladding, sculptural curves highlighted by two illuminating elliptical skylights & Inlite designer lighting combine seamlessly to create a timeless aesthetic throughout.
Designed with both grand-scale entertaining & relaxed family living in mind, a series of interconnected light saturated formal & informal living & dining spaces offer remarkable flexibility. Elegant yet inviting, the formal lounge & dining room are enhanced by bespoke cabinetry. The family living room with a gas fireplace & casual dining area with a custom fitted desk & cabinetry are framed by walls of full-height glass windows & stacker doors that spill onto a vast elevated decked balcony, where leafy garden views create a stunning backdrop for indoor-outdoor living & entertaining. At the heart of the home, a breathtaking Carrara marble kitchen with a concealed butler’s pantry & an additional fully fitted kitchenette is as functional as it is beautiful. It features a suite of high-end appliances (including two dishwashers, a microwave & large fridge/freezer), elegantly curved benchtops/central island, Italian Laminati, Blum cabinetry, premium tapware & storage galore. Privately positioned away from the living areas, the luxurious main bedroom suite delivers a true hotel-style experience. The bespoke dressing room/walk-in robe is guaranteed to wow, while an indulgent ensuite showcases a freestanding bath, oversized double shower, dual vanity & exceptional storage. In the main bedroom a cleverly concealed spiral staircase provides direct access to the children's accommodation below without crossing the main living areas. An additional bedroom with built-in robes & a beautifully appointed bathroom offers the perfect retreat for guests/young children. A striking circular staircase descends to the equally impressive lower level, where intelligent design, flawless finishes & family functionality continue throughout. A substantial rumpus room/children's retreat, complete with extensive storage & bifold doors opens seamlessly to a generous paved alfresco entertaining area & a blissfully private rear garden surrounded by magnificent Magnolia trees & vibrant Boston Ivy. Complete with a custom-built basketball court, this peaceful outdoor space has been designed for family fun. Thoughtfully planned to accommodate large families & guests/extended family, the lower level incorporates an innovative "airlock" design that allows sections of the home to be independently closed off when desired. This includes a well-appointed large family bathroom, a custom fitted laundry complete with commercial grade Speed Queen washer & dryer, additional fridge/freezer, extensive storage & a privately accessed guest bedroom with its own ensuite & secure side entry. The ensuite also enjoys direct access from the garden, making it ideal for use during outdoor entertaining. The remaining downstairs accommodation comprises three generous bedrooms, each with built-in robes & desks, including one with its own stylish ensuite. Completing the lower level is a secluded home office with a built-in desk & lined with floor-to-ceiling bookshelves. This exceptional home also delivers hydronic heating throughout, individually controlled heating/cooling in every room, video intercom, substantial storage throughout, irrigation, a lavish powder room, a mudroom & an oversized double garage. Ideally positioned in one of Caulfield North’s most desired & convenient locations, close to vibrant shops & cafes, elite schools, parklands & a choice of transport options. *Approximate Title Dimensions.
